    JoyRx expanding music footprint in Austin children's hospitals, clinics
    AUSTIN (KXAN) — For more than 26 years, JoyRx has been bringing live music and instrumental lessons to children and teenagers hospitalized, battling cancer or facing health complications. Now, the organization is working to expand its footprint in the Austin area to connect more children with music as a form of healing.JoyRx started in Portland, Oregon before expanding its efforts to Austin in 2018.     Austin man arrested for connections to multiple armed robberies
    TRAVIS COUNTY, Texas (KXAN) — The Travis County Sheriff's Office arrested an Austin man Sunday morning in connection to a convenience store armed robbery in north Austin.
    Marier Tyler, 17, was arrested Sunday morning. TCSO said he is connected to multiple other robberies in Austin, Round Rock and Travis County.

    Teen injured after being shot in Round Rock neighborhood
    ROUND ROCK, Texas (KXAN) – A teenager was injured after being shot Saturday night, according to the Round Rock Police Department.RRPD said the shooting occurred at approximately 7:35 p.m. in the 1700 block of Onion Creek Village Drive.First responders provide aid, and the teen was taken to the hospital with a non-life-threatening injury.Round Rock police said there was no indication of a threat to the public, and the investigation is ongoing.

    Power restored to more than 5,000 near Lago Vista
    TRAVIS COUNTY (KXAN) — As the June heat wave continues, 5,803 Pedernales Electric Cooperative (PEC) customers are without power in Travis County, Burnet County and Kimble County. A PEC spokesperson tells KXAN that a transformer fire caused the outage. Technicians are on-site working to repair the issue. The current estimated restoration time is 8:15 p.m., according to a tweet by PEC. Customers can visit the company’s website for updates.
